Using strychnine neuronography, the connections of proreal and orbital convolutions with different sections of the neocortex were studied, in cats. The proreal cortex was found to have direct efferent connections with premotor, motor, and associative sections of the sigmoid gyrus and with the anterior lateral convolution. Besides, the orbital convolution has connections with the auditory, visual, and associative sections of the neocortex. The orbital cortex was concluded to be the basic efferent system of the orbito--frontal cortex providing the latter's conncetions with different sections of the neocortex; the proreal cortex projects efferents only to adjacent sections of the frontal cortex.
